What’s somethings wrong, when I change monitor?

The problem can affect both LCD and CRT monitors. The graphics settings in Windows are too high for the monitor to display. To resolve this problem, start Windows in Safe Mode by holding down the F8 key when you restart the computer.

Try to restart Windows with “Safe Mode” and then go to the graphic adapter settings:

  1. Right-click your desktop and then Click “Properties”
  2. Click the “Settings” tab.
  3. Display Properties

  4. At Screen Resolution slider. Sliding this toward the left will lower your screen resolution.  If you using  1088 x  612 pixels try to change to 1024 x 768

I try to connect Exter USB hard disk and not things happen !

“I’m using Windows XP SP2 and try to use External USB hard disk, It can detect with some computer but some computer can’t found anything.  I found green power on USB hard disk, but why can’t use.”

Try to check step by step below;

Check USB Driver

  1. Right-click on “My Computer” then select “Properties”
  2. Select tab “Hardware” then click “Device Manager”
  3. Check “Universal Serial Bus controllers” if found  “!”
  4. Right-click on “!” and then select “Update Driver”
  5. Select “Yes, this time only” and then click “Next”
  6. Select “Install the software automatic”  (try to update and re-install USB port)

If can’t,  try to add more power

  1. Using additional power from your USB Hard Drive (Adapter)
  2. Using additional cable (2 USB port in one cable)

PaperCut is an open-source freeware program for creating paper models you can print, cut out, and glue together. It is mostly for fun. It does some cool things like generating geodesic domes and stellating shapes, and allows you to decorate them with pictures and text. All the pictures of models you see on this site were constructed using PaperCut.

You can create all kinds of geometric shapes - all the Platonic solids, many of the Archimedean solids, and lots more. Make a photocube or a photo-dodecahedron.
